History Norgen Biotek, founded by Professor Yousef Haj-Ahmad in 1998, is an industry leader in research and application of technologies relating to molecular biology. Specializing in sample preparation, Norgen Biotek works with the purification, concentration, and clean-up of DNA, RNA, and proteins found in various specimen types. Their techniques and innovation have helped to develop over 70 sample preparation kits that are used worldwide for various purposes. Additionally, one of the primary goals for Norgen Biotek is to commit particular attention to non-invasion sample preparation, which offers a distrinct number of advantages for diagnostics. Additionally, the organization also does all of the necessary manufacturing for their products. In the molecular biology realm, Norgen Biotek continues to strive for excellence and stay ahead of the curve in sample preparation and diagnostic technology.
How does Niagara affect your business? "We are one of the top ten life sciences companies in Canada and locating in Niagara has been a key component in our formula for success. A significant portion of our revenue comes from the US and our location here gives us immediate access to over 50% of the American market within a day's drive. But the key benefit for us is the cost of doing business here. We are within an hour of Canada's business capital and we are paying significantly less in terms of rent and labour. And with a major University and College right here, we always have a fresh pool of young, highly educated talent on hand. Our location in the Niagara Region is a vital element in our continued growth." - Dr. Yousef Haj-Ahmad, President, Founder, Norgen Biotek Visit Norgen Biotek Corp's website
